However, installing a cat flap in a uPVC door can be a challenge for some homeowners. There are a few ways to simplify the procedure. You must first measure the height of your pet. This will allow you to determine the correct height for the cat flap. You must then mark the desired shape onto the uPVC panel. It can be either an oval or a circle. You should also ensure that the mark and the cut are straight.

Once you have created the marking on the uPVC panel and you are ready to make use of a jigsaw to cut out the design. Make sure that you are using a fine cutting blade typically made for use with uPVC or metal. This will ensure that you don't harm the material of your door.

In some instances, it may be necessary to use a saw made of metal to cut the desired shape from a uPVC panel. Wear a mask in this case. You could end up inhaling some of the chemicals used in the manufacture of uPVC panel.

You can also purchase a new uPVC panel that has a pre-made hole for the cat flap. You can purchase this from an expert. In this scenario, the uPVC panel will be installed in place of the glass sealed unit. The cost for this service is between PS100 between PS100 and PS200.

Fitting a cat flap onto your uPVC panel is fairly simple. It's doable to do it yourself. However, it is best to work slowly. It's essential to ensure that the hole you make is the c frame. Ideally, you should put it at the same height as the belly button of your pet.

It is also possible to fit a cat flap into windows, but it is a less safe alternative. Double-glazed glass is sprayed. If you make an opening, air could be introduced into the unit, causing it to mist or steam up. This is not an issue with windows that are single-glazed.

Adding a cat flap can be a challenging task. This is because double-glazed panels are sealed units and cutting into them is dangerous. This could also harm the insulation properties of the door, allowing moisture enter. This will cause condensation between the panes when temperatures change.

You can, however, install a pet flap in the uPVC door panel without replacing the entire panel. It is essential to find a specialist that can install the flap in a replacement window. They can also replace a glass panel with solid uPVC sheet which is a much cheaper option than a brand-new door. Alternately, you can ask your glazier to fit the flap on an entirely new door, with the pane already removed. It's more expensive than replacing the glass pane, but you may save money over the course of time.
